Who needs certified professional estimator?
01
Certified professional estimators are needed by various individuals and organizations including:
02
- Construction companies: They require estimators to accurately assess project costs and develop competitive bids.
03
- Architectural firms: Estimators play a crucial role in estimating material quantities and costs for architectural designs.
04
- Engineering companies: Estimators assist in cost estimation for engineering projects and help with budget planning.
05
- Government agencies: Estimators are essential for estimating costs of public infrastructure projects and ensuring efficient use of resources.
06
- Independent contractors: Contractors often need certified estimators to provide accurate cost estimates for their proposals.
07
Anyone involved in the field of estimation, project planning, or budgeting can benefit from obtaining a certified professional estimator designation to enhance their credibility and expertise.
